The ingredients needed to make Pesto Roasted Asparagus:
  1. Prepare 2 bundles asparagus; trimmed
  2. Get 1 lemon; zested
  3. Take 1 t onion powder
  4. Take 1 recipe "Bacon-Arugula Chicken" (see my recipes, omit chicken)
  5. Prepare 1 small pinch kosher salt & black pepper
  6. Take as needed EVOO

Instructions to make Pesto Roasted Asparagus:
  1. Toss asparagus with enough oil to coat. Season with onion powder, salt and pepper. Add 1 C pesto. Toss. Lay flat on a baking tray lined with parchment paper. Scoop all pesto out of the bowl atop the asparagus. Bake at 400° for approximately 15 minutes or until asparagus is tender.
  2. Garnish with lemon zest.
